Overview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et

Neuropathic pain relief is provided by the combined medication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et. This oral tablet interrupts pain signal transmission to the brain, reducing pain perception. It can be taken with or without food, ideally at bedtime, consistently at the same time daily for optimal blood levels. Missed doses should be taken immediately upon recollection. Complete the prescribed course, even with symptom improvement. Sudden cessation without consulting your physician is strongly discouraged, as it may exacerbate symptoms. Common side effects include constipation, urinary difficulty, weight gain, fatigue, and dry mouth. Dizziness and drowsiness are also possible; avoid driving or mentally demanding tasks until the medication's effects are understood. Weight gain may occur; maintain a balanced diet and regular exercise to mitigate this. Report any unusual mood shifts to your doctor immediately, as suicidal ideation is a potential side effect. Prior to commencing treatment, disclose any kidney or liver conditions, and provide a complete list of all other medications currently being taken, as interactions may affect Gabmab NT's efficacy. Inform your physician of pregnancy, pregnancy plans, or breastfeeding.

How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et works:

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ets contain gabapentin and nortriptyline, working synergistically to alleviate neuropathic pain. Gabapentin, an alpha-2-delta ligand, reduces pain by modulating nerve cell calcium channels. Nortriptyline, a tricyclic antidepressant, elevates serotonin and noradrenaline, neurotransmitters that inhibit pain signal transmission within the brain. This combined action provides effective pain relief for nerve damage.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Concurrent use of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ets and alcohol may result in heightened somnolence.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ible risks prior to prescribing. Physician consultation is advised.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ates a potential for the medication to transfer to breast milk, posing a risk to the infant.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Driving ability may be impaired by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et side effects, due to potential drowsiness caused by the medication.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ets. Dosage modification of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ult your physician for guidance. Report any jaundice symptoms to your doctor immediately while using this medication.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ets are contraindicated in patients with severe hepatic dysfunction.

What if you forget to take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et :

Should you forget to take a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et, administer it immediately. However,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et

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g tablets combine gabapentin and nortriptyline to alleviate neuropathic pain. By affecting brain activity, this medication soothes damaged or overactive nerves, reducing pain signals.
Don't discontinue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et even if your pain subsides; continue as prescribed. Abrupt cessation may cause withdrawal symptoms including anxiety, insomnia, nausea, pain, and sweating. Your doctor should supervise any gradual dose reduction before complete discontinuation.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ablets may increase appetite, potentially leading to weight gain. Preventing this weight gain is simpler than losing it later. Maintain a healthy, balanced diet without enlarging portions. Avoid high-calorie foods like soft drinks, fried foods, chips, pastries, and sweets. Between meals, opt for fruits, vegetables, and low-calorie snacks instead of junk food. Regular exercise further helps prevent weight gain. A combination of healthy eating and regular exercise may help you avoid weight gain altogether.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ablets may impact sexual function in both men and women, potentially causing reduced libido, erectile dysfunction, difficulty achieving orgasm, decreased satisfaction, or discomfort during intercourse. If you experience these side effects, consult your doctor, but do not discontinue the medication without their advice.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et rarely causes serious side effects. Seek immediate medical attention if you experience: altered body temperature, breathing difficulties, rapid heartbeat, weakness, gait instability, impaired coordination or slowed reflexes, unusual mood or behavior changes (restlessness, anxiety, or excitement), depression, hallucinations, irrational thoughts, blurred or double vision, involuntary eye movements (nystagmus), visual disturbances, or signs of frequent infection (fever, chills, sore throat, or mouth sores). While uncommon, these serious side effects require prompt medical care.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et may show initial effects within two weeks, but full benefits typically appear within two to three months. Some patients may require a longer treatment period.
Missed a dose of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ablet? If it's alm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and continue as usual. Otherwise, take it as soon as you remember, then resume your regular schedule. Never double the dose; this can increase side effects. If unsure, consult your doctor.
Seek immediate medical attention, contacting your doctor or the nearest hospital's emergency room, even without apparent symptoms. Urgent care is necessary as an overdose may cause drowsiness, weakness, gait instability, diplopia, slurred speech, diarrhea, confusion, blurred vision, dizziness, fluctuating body temperature, respiratory distress, and tachycardia.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ablets can affect your alertness and coordination. Avoid driving or operating machinery while taking this medication. Alcohol consumption should be avoided as it can intensify Gabmab NT's effects. Grapefruit and grapefruit juice may also interact negatively; therefore, avoid them. Increased sun sensitivity is a potential side effect; wear protective clothing and sunscreen when outdoors.
Regular check-ups with your doctor are recommended while taking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ablets. Consult your doctor immediately if your symptoms don't improve with the prescribed dosage, or if you experience persistent side effects impacting your daily life.
Gabmab NT 300mg/10mg Tablets can cause drowsiness or sudden sleep onset, sometimes without warning. Avoid hazardous activities like driving, operating machinery, or working at heights, especially initially, until you understand the medication's effects. Report any such episodes to your doctor.
Increasing your dosage beyond the recommended amount won't necessarily improve results; it could instead lead to serious side effects and toxicity. If your symptoms worsen despite taking the prescribed dose, seek medical advice.
Don't open the tablet pack until needed. Store the pack in a cool, dry place, away from children. Dispose of unused medication properly to prevent accidental ingestion by children, pets, or others.
